First chapters of my new Drupal 6 book are on line

Tagged:  

After many other projects I found the time to write a Drupal 6 book and record a new Drupal 6 video training.

Of course, it is in German language because of my origin. The book will be available on line for free at http://drupal.cocoate.com. It consists of three parts. Today I have published part 1 (the introduction and chapter 1-3). Part 2 will be published at August, 4th and part 3 at August, 11th.

The German Drupal video training is released and is seems, that it will be translated or better "new recorded" in French language.

For the book, the German publisher negotiates with an American publisher for a translation and they asked me to translate the table of content and the chapter 11, which is about CCK. My daughter Isabell did the tranlation of the texts and I did new screenshots. So a small part of the book is now earlier available for free in English than in German language Smiling.

cross cooking & learning

With our company eduate.eu we are partner in several european projects. The focus of these projects are learning from each other, share experiences, do things together, developing special skills etc. - all in a European view.

The project I want to talk about is a G2 Learning Partnership Project and it is funded by the European Commission in the framework of Socrates. Funded by the European Commission means not that you can spend thousands of Euros in nice bars in Brussels. Funded means, that you get the flight costs (up to a limit) and a bit money for paper and printer ink in the office and so on.

Eduate.eu (Christine Graf) is the project coordinator of the Cross Cooking project.

Project description:
The project aims to rediscover and preserve traditions in cooking across Europe, whilst enhancing the possibilities of learning and cross-generational and cultural cohesion - read more.

So in these kind of projects there is no real money (in the sence of getting rich) involved and most of the people do not have IT skills. All of these projects needs a website and a communication system (even Phone, Skype, E-Mail, whatever). For most of the smaller projects it is nearly impossible to do something more than five HTML pages with the outcomes of the project. For this project we wanted to make few things different. We choosed Drupal and tried to develop the website in a way that the project participants can follow the development and still be able to use the website. That means no special design, no individual module development, etc because that would be too expensive. Another decision was to open all the content and the discussions, because we spend European tax money and the website visitors should see everything. If there were technical needs during the project, we installed a contributed module and tried to find a clever solution. The project started with Drupal 4.6 and now we have Drupal 5.7

And now?

After one and a half year and several meetings (real & virtual) the group has written a European cookbook in many languages on-line! This cookbook is a collaborative work made with the Drupal book module by people who never touched a computer before.

cookbook

Because they want to share all the recipes from Wales, Germany, Italy, Finland & Hungary  they decided that the cookbook is downloadable for free (download here). It is also possible to buy it but the most important thing is to try out cooking Smiling

cookbook

From my perspective this was a wonderful project and the group has reached much more for the development in Europe than they expected at the beginning!

And I am very happy about the fact, that Drupal is one big Lego Brick in this project.
